Проблемы со сборкой приложения react-native, как исправить?

Проблемы со сборкой приложения React Native могут быть вызваны различными факторами, и чтобы их исправить, необходимо провести некоторые действия.

1. Первым шагом я рекомендую убедиться, что ваше окружение настроено правильно. Убедитесь, что у вас установлены Node.js, NPM и JDK (Java Development Kit). Убедитесь, что переменные среды настроены правильно для доступа ко всем необходимым инструментам и пакетам.

2. Если вы не уверены в верности настройки окружения, я рекомендую переустановить Node.js и JDK, следуя официальной документации для вашей операционной системы.

3. Проверьте версию React Native, которую вы используете, и сравните ее с версией, для которой написано ваше приложение. В некоторых случаях обновление React Native до последней версии может решить проблемы сборки.

4. Обновите зависимости вашего проекта, прежде всего, в папке "node_modules". Откройте терминал в папке вашего проекта и выполните команду npm install или yarn install, чтобы обновить все необходимые пакеты.

5. Иногда проблемы возникают из-за конфликтов версий пакетов. Проверьте файл "package.json" вашего проекта и убедитесь, что все зависимости указаны с надлежащими версиями. Если есть конфликты, попробуйте обновить или откатить версии, чтобы устранить проблемы.

6. Если вы используете iOS, обновите и пересоберите проект в Xcode. Выполните команду react-native run-ios в терминале, чтобы автоматически обновить и пересобрать проект с использованием последней конфигурации.

7. Если у вас возникли проблемы с сетью или зависимостями Native-модулей, убедитесь, что вы правильно добавили все необходимые разрешения и настройки. Проверьте файл "AndroidManifest.xml" (для Android) и файл Info.plist (для iOS) на наличие необходимых разрешений и конфигураций.

8. Если все вышеперечисленные шаги не привели к решению проблемы, я рекомендую поискать решение в официальной документации React Native, на форумах разработчиков или в каталогах ошибок на GitHub.

В целом, проблемы со сборкой приложения React Native могут быть вызваны различными факторами, и для их исправления может потребоваться некоторое время и ответственность. Важно тщательно анализировать ошибки, исследовать возможные причины и применять соответствующие меры, чтобы устранить проблемы и успешно собрать ваше приложение.